Common Orthopedic Conditions

Orthopedic conditions encompass a wide range of disorders affecting the musculoskeletal system, which includes bones, joints, ligaments, tendons, and muscles. Common orthopedic conditions include osteoarthritis, a degenerative joint disease leading to pain and stiffness; rheumatoid arthritis, an autoimmune condition causing inflammation and joint damage; and tendinitis, characterized by inflammation of tendons often resulting from overuse.

Additionally, fractures, which are breaks in bones due to trauma, and sprains, involving ligament injuries, are frequently encountered. Other conditions include bursitis, inflammation of the bursae, and carpal tunnel syndrome, caused by compression of the median nerve at the wrist. Understanding these common conditions is essential for effective diagnosis and management, ultimately enhancing patient outcomes and quality of life.

Innovative Treatment Options

Advancements in medical technology and research have led to a variety of innovative treatment options for orthopedic conditions. Among these, minimally invasive surgical techniques are gaining prominence, allowing for reduced recovery times and fewer complications. Regenerative medicine, including stem cell therapy and platelet-rich plasma (PRP) injections, offers promising alternatives for tissue repair and pain management. Additionally, robotic-assisted surgery enhances precision in procedures, improving outcomes for patients.

Biologic treatments are also evolving, utilizing the body's own healing mechanisms to address musculoskeletal issues. Furthermore, custom implants and 3D printing technology provide tailored solutions for individual patient needs. Collectively, these advancements represent a significant shift toward more effective, efficient, and patient-centered orthopedic care, ultimately improving quality of life for those affected by these conditions.

Role of Physical Therapy

A comprehensive approach to recovery often includes physical therapy as a crucial component in managing orthopedic conditions. Physical therapy focuses on restoring function, reducing pain, and improving mobility through tailored exercise programs, manual therapy, and patient education. By enhancing strength and flexibility, physical therapists help patients regain confidence in their movements and mitigate the risk of future injuries.

Additionally, physical therapy can address specific conditions such as post-surgical rehabilitation, arthritis, or sports-related injuries, enabling individuals to return to their activities more quickly and safely.

The collaborative relationship between physical therapists and other healthcare professionals ensures a multidisciplinary approach, optimizing patient outcomes and promoting long-term wellness. This holistic strategy empowers patients to take an active role in their recovery journey and overall health management.
